  • Title

    A new high performance zero-voltage zero-current mixed mode switching DC/DC converter

  • Abstract
    A high-performance DC-DC converter that has good DC characteristics and operates on constant-frequency, variable-duty mode in a wide load range is proposed. It also has low switching loss, low voltage stress, and low electromagnetic interference. Owing to these features, the converter overcomes most of the limitations of resonant and quasi-resonant converters, such as high VA rating of resonant elements, variable frequency operation, and limited load range, and improves on the efficiency and DC characteristics of the pseudo-resonant converter. The proposed converter is thought to be suitable for high-power applications (above several kVA) as well as for low-power applications with high power density and high performance. Simulation results are shown under the conditions of 100 kHz and 1 kVA load
